The idea of retiring at a certain age is a common expectation for many individuals. For some, this may mean retiring at age 65, while for others it may be later in life. Regardless of the specific age, preplanning is crucial in order to ensure a successful and fulfilling retirement. This may include saving enough money, considering where to live, and deciding on how to spend one’s time in retirement.

One major factor to consider when planning for retirement is the financial aspect. Ensuring that one has saved enough money to live comfortably during retirement is crucial. This may involve setting aside money in a retirement savings account, such as a 401k or IRA, and making calculated decisions about investments and spending.

Another important aspect of retirement planning is deciding on how to spend one’s time. For some, retirement may mean a life of leisure, including traveling and pursuing hobbies. Others may choose to engage in volunteer activities or even pursue a new career. The decision on how to spend one’s time in retirement will likely be influenced by individual interests and passions….
